§ 79-2933 — Time for budget hearing; adoption; validity of levies

Text

The hearing herein required to be held upon all budgets by all taxing subdivisions or municipalities of the state shall be held not less than ten (10) days prior to the date on which they shall certify their annual levies to the county clerk as required by law. After such hearing the budget shall be adopted or amended and adopted as amended, but no levy shall be made until and unless a budget is prepared, published and filed, but no levy of taxes shall be invalidated because of any insufficiency, informality, or delay in preparing, publishing and filing said budget.

Legislative History

L. 1933, ch. 316, § 9; L. 1941, ch. 377, § 8; L. 1970, ch. 387, § 4; March 13.
